#770036 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#770036 is composed of 46.7% red, 0%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 100% magenta, 54.6% yellow and 53.3% black. It has a hue angle of 332.8 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 23.3%. #770036 color hex could be obtained by blending #ee006c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

Shades and Tints of #770036

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#ffedf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#770036

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#40373b is the less saturated color, while #770036 is the most saturated one.
